If you are a mother of a two-year-old, I am pretty sure you can relate to the scene described above. That’s why I was thrilled when I found out about Bambino Zip, Little Bambino Children’s Wear’s back zip sweater.

I received a size one taupe hoodie with Chinese lanterns and cherry blossoms on the front. The Asian-inspired graphics really make a statement–they are so hip! The sweater is made from bamboo fibres and organic cotton; it feels really soft to touch and seems very comfortable for kids to play in.

The tag had instructions to wash and dry the sweater before use because it would shrink. I tried it on my daughter before washing and was positively surprised to notice it was big on her (she’s 25 months old). After washing and drying, it did shrink a bit, but still fit my daughter nicely. In fact, I think she will use her trendy sweater for quite awhile. Two thumbs up for Little Bambino sizing.

 

The zip on the back has to be my favorite feature though. It’s one of the most brilliant ideas I’ve ever seen when it comes to children’s clothing. Really, how come no one thought of this before? It’s very easy to put it on your kid (no more stuck heads!), and so convenient to take it out when your little one is sleeping on your shoulder. Not to mention that, of course, kids can’t unzip it at all. I got lots of compliments from friends on my daughter’s new cool sweater.

As with many other Vancouver businesses, mom entrepreneurs Lindsey Marston and Alisa Smith, Little Bambino founders, also care about our environment. Their line of baby clothes is made from eco-friendly fibres like bamboo and organic cotton. And they only use low-impact dyes, water-based inks and nickel-free snaps and zippers.

Besides the original back zip sweater, Little Bambino also sells pants and bodysuits. The Bambino Zip ($49.95) comes in two sizes (six months and one year) and two colour options (blue for boys and taupe for girls).
